ASE 2020 Podcast ep 14: Di Henry – Games Girl

August 31, 2021
-
Posted by Podcast

Di Henry’s first parade involved 1000 sheep and a bullock train trundling through the Sydney CBD to promote the Royal Easter Show, and she brought out Robosauraus to the RES.

From that she went on to Mardi Gras parades and then the 2000 Sydney Olympic torch relay followed by a dozen more Olympics, Commonwealth and Asian Games relays.

Di spent 2012 in England organising events for the City of London including a royal wedding, and the London Olympics city activations.

Then back to the Sydney RES for another stint followed by the Paramasala Festival in Parramatta.
